Summer Salon: Grounded in Clay "Kitchen Table" Curators' Talk & Tour
Beginning with a guided tour of Grounded in Clay: The Spirit of Pueblo Pottery, this special program continues with a meaningful roundtable discussion on “The Role of Pueblo Pottery & Pottery Collaborations in the 2020s”featuring curators and voices from the Pueblo Pottery Collective.
Experience the living legacy of Pueblo pottery through conversation, community, and the enduring spirit of clay. Light refreshments will be served.
Moderator: Brian Vallo (Pueblo of Acoma) with Speakers: Monica Silva Lovato (Pueblo of San Felipe/Santo Domingo Pueblo), Stephanie Riley (Pueblo of Acoma), and Albert Alvidrez (Ysleta del Sur Pueblo).
